144 Acres - Forestburg, Texas
Premier Cross Timbers Hunting & Homesite Ranch
Welcome to 144 acres of raw, untouched land located in the highly desirable Forestburg area of Montague County, Texas. Held in the same family for over 100 years, this ranch is available for purchase for the first time in generations. This exceptional property offers a rare opportunity to own a true blank canvas in the heart of the Cross Timbers region. With over 80 feet of elevation change, breathtaking views, towering hardwoods, and a year-round deep-water creek, this ranch is loaded with character and potential.
The land is raw, heavily wooded with mature hardwoods that dominate the property, including numerous 100-year-old oak and pecan trees that stand as living monuments to the ranch's rich history. From a hunting perspective, this ranch checks all the boxes. Forestburg is widely known for producing quality whitetail deer, and the heavy timber cover, natural water source, and multiple open areas ideal for food plot development create exceptional habitat. With strategic management and selective clearing, this property has the potential to become a premier hunting ranch. The deep creek, holding water year-round, winds through the property and serves as a natural travel corridor for wildlife while adding both beauty and functionality. The topography allows for natural funnel points, while the dense cover provides bedding areas that can hold deer. Hogs, turkey, dove, and small game further enhance the recreational value.
The property features large elevation changes creating amazing views. From the hilltops, you'll experience breathtaking sunset views that stretch across hardwood-covered ridges, perfect for a custom home with a wide back porch and rocking chairs facing west. LOCATION:
- Forestburg, Montague County, Texas
- 22 miles to Bowie
- 31 miles to Gainesville
- 33 miles to Sanger
- 70 miles to Dallas
WATER:
- Deep creek holding water year-round
- Natural drainage throughout property
- Potential for future pond development
CLIMATE:
- North Texas climate
- Average annual rainfall approximately 35 inches
- Ideal growing conditions for native grasses, hardwoods, and wildlife habitat
UTILITIES:
- Electricity on site
- Water well required
- No known municipal water
WILDLIFE:
- Whitetail deer (Forestburg known for quality genetics)
- Hogs
- Turkey
- Dove
- Small game
Excellent habitat with heavy timber cover and multiple food plot locations.
MINERALS:
- Minerals do not convey
- Three oil pad sites located on the western side of the property
- Pad sites are tucked away and do not detract from overall beauty or usability
VEGETATION:
- Mature hardwoods throughout
- 100+ year-old oak and pecan trees
- Native grasses
- Mix of timber and open pasture
TERRAIN:
- Rolling hills
- Over 80 feet of elevation change
- Expansive Cross Timbers views
- Multiple prime build sites
SOILS:
- Native sandy loam and clay soils typical of the Cross Timbers region
- Suitable for grazing, wildlife management, and food plot development
TAXES:
- Agricultural exemption in place (buyer to verify)
IMPROVEMENTS:
- Electricity installed
- Road frontage on Die Mound Road
- Three oil pad sites (western portion of property)
No structural improvements - offering a true blank slate for development.
